LIFE ClimaWin holds a technical conference on climate change mitigation in the wine sector.
Description
The next event organized by the LIFE ClimaWin Project will bring together experts, researchers, and professionals from the wine industry for a day focused on climate change mitigation in vineyards and wineries , combining technical knowledge, real-life experiences, and dialogue between key stakeholders.
The event will take place at the Bosque de Matasnos facilities, a benchmark in wine sustainability, and will feature a full agenda that includes a project presentation, a technical visit, and a workshop with leading specialists.

This technical meeting is part of the work of the LIFE ClimaWin Operational Group, an initiative aimed at developing and validating climate-smart solutions in the field of viticulture , contributing to the decarbonization of the sector and greater resilience to the effects of climate change.
